Abstract

Livestock is an integral part of everyday life contributing to the social, cultural, and economic sectors. Livestock farming faces challenges in animal remote management and monitoring, due to cost constraints and product quality requirements. The latest development of smart techniques, especially the Internet of Things (IoT) and cloud devices/services provide significant potential for efficient and secure farm management. This paper presents a review of smart farm management and monitoring systems for livestock based on IoT techniques, including the monitoring of animal behavior, weather condition, environment, and more. The review provides a comprehensive understanding of the sensing techniques, data analysis, communication, hardware, and software used in existing smart livestock solutions.
